Of course it could be because I am a newby to LibreOffice, but IMHO the one thing that would improve LibreOffice Writer, especially when dealing with multiple images placed in to a Writer document, would be the ability to select all the placed images and then use the align and distribute functions! Unfortunately, there does not seem to be anyway to select multiple inserted images within a Writer page or document. The only way I was able to complete the said task was to place the images in to a Drawing Document, select them all, then  use the align and distribute function. I then grouped the images and copied and pasted them into my Writer document. This is such a basic function used by many people writing reports, that it is either a bug or a gaping omission! If Libre Office Draw has this capability please make it so in LibreOffice Writer.

Steps to Reproduce:
1.Insert multiple images in to a writer document
2.Try to select multiple images using Shift key/ or Command key by a click on each image
3. Failed to select multiple images >>>> Resort to using LibreOffice Draw to do the required task
4. Copy aligned and distributed images from Draw 
5. Paste in to Writer document.

The main issue described here is the inability in Writer to select multiple raster images with Shift + Click, or drag-and-drop rectangle selection, which is a duplicate of bug 34438. Marking as a duplicate.
